Transaction 839415e7cd62c62055596cb8088d7545e4f3441990c526f733b0353cd9373335
1 Input
1 Output
-
839415e7cd62c62055596cb8088d7545e4f3441990c526f733b0353cd9373335:0
- value
- 2860680
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6589b383eb2b13510cc32ec8bfa03296d80f81f0 OP_EQUAL
- address
- 3Awu8ZtnXcZwv2rXZY8AG6eNUezVoFMHye